Moving BC via Winclone to a new computer....

Question regarding moving/installing a bc partition to a new computer. I have a backup via winclone of my MBPro windows setup that I would like to install on my new Imac. I understand a different driver setup will be needed via the create a driver disk etc.
However, I am unsure if this will work moving to a new computer. Has anyone done this and if so, what is the process? Simply restore like you would with a HD upgrade and then load new drivers???

Moving Windows XP from computer to computer is fairly easy using PC's. I just clone the drive, then boot up with the install media and perform a "repair install". It is like an upgrade, except that all it does is remove the hardware from the device manager, and re-detect it. I've never tried this under BootCamp, but it seems to me that you might be able to make it work if you follow the WinClone restore procedures, then after it is done, boot to your XP install and run the repair install process. Another thing you might want to do is to uninstall your existing BootCamp drivers under windows before you make the move. Following that, the install on the new machine might go a little cleaner...

  • Need help moving photoshop 7.0.1 to new computer

    I hope everyone is doing well. I also hope someone can help me out. I need to move/load Photoshop 7.0.1 onto a different computer - o/s Windows XP Professional v.2002. We are a small company with no IT department and the original CDs and product keys/proof of purchase are lonnnnnnnnng gone. Upgrading is not an option at this time, the powers that be will most likely tell me to do my photoshop work on the laptop, but I want everything at my fingertips at my desk. Too much to ask? Apparently it is because I cannot figure out how to load onto my desktop.
    I've read, in several places, that Adobe allows the user to download the software to two computers, but I don't know if its ever been loaded elsewhere and when I moved the file from my laptop to our rustic server - didn't work. Then I tried copying everything to a memory stick and moving it to my new computer BUT there is no .exe file when I do this. I can't make it run. And never did I receive an messages that scream - hey you, you can't load this on more than two computers.
    I called Adobe and they informed me that they no longer support this version over the phone and that I should check out the forums. Unfortunately, I cannot find the info I need on the forum. Perhaps I'm using the wrong terminology in my search - I have tried several variations...loading, moving, reinstalling....and come up empty. Actually, come up with lots of stuff (from years ago) that doesn't help. In one post I thought could be the holy grail, there was a link that bottomed out - took me nowhere.
    I don't what else to do, I don't know what the google anymore. I'm hopeful someone has an answer other than an upgrade. Thanks.

    Note that I am assuming you're properly licensed to be able to run the app on your new computer.  I do not propose doing anything illegal.
    With the ollld versions of Photoshop, like the one you have, you can try going through a process like this:
    1.  Copy the entire c:\Program Files\Adobe\Photoshop 7.0 folder to the new computer.
    2.  Try to run Photoshop on the new computer.
    3.  Note any "missing DLL" message.
    4.  Locate the DLL on the old computer (e.g., in C:\Windows\System32 or wherever), and copy it to the same place on the new computer.
    5.  Repeat steps 2 through 4 until no more "missing DLL" messages present themselves.
    There may be other types of messages you'll see.  They're usually descriptive enough to be able to determine what it's looking for that it does not have.  If you get one you're unsure of how to handle, post it here.

  • Moving library from external HD to new computer

    I currently use iPhoto 5.0.4 on my iBook. The entire library has been backed up onto an external hard drive. I intend to get a new computer (probably an iMac) soon, and I will want to move the entire library onto the new computer, either from the external HD or the iBook itself.
    Since the new computer's library will be empty, is it possible to just copy the existing "iPhoto Library" folder onto the new computer in the Pictures folder? (I'm assuming there's a Pictures folder.) Will iPhoto '09 handle/convert it as necessary or will there be a follow-up step? Do I also need to copy the com.apple.iphoto.plist file?
    If the answer to the first question is no, what do I need to do to maintain the integrity of the library as it's set up? I am aware film rolls will be converted to Events, but don't know if the film rolls will stay in place if I simply use an import command to bring in the entire library.

    Since the new computer's library will be empty, is it possible to just copy the existing "iPhoto Library" folder onto the new computer in the Pictures folder?
    Yes. That's the recommended method. When iPhoto is launched it will look in the Pictures folder, open and convert the library to the new format. Just be sure to have a backup copy of the older library version just in case.
    If you have any film rolls that are identified by Roll #xx they will be converted to an event with the illuminating titled of "untitled event". So if you get the chance, rename those rolls to a description that will describe the contents so the new events will have the same name.
